Ox Gallstones: A Deep Investigation into Cattle Bile Stone Makeup

Ox gall stones, formed within the gallbladder of bovines, present a complex combination of organic and inorganic substances . Primarily, they consist of biliverdin, which has undergone oxidation and crystallized along with calcium salts, phosphate salts, and often, minor levels of fatty compounds. The precise ratio of these ingredients varies significantly depending on the nutrition of the animal and its overall well-being , contributing to the diverse appearance and attributes read more observed in these concretions.

Cow & Bull Gall Bladder Stones: Harvesting , Treatment, and Likely Advantages

The procurement of bovine and bull gallstones is a relatively simple process , often occurring as a side effect of meat packing operations. At first , the concretions are cautiously extracted from the gall bladder . Afterward, treatment can involve simple rinsing with water and drying , or sophisticated methods like crushing into a powder . Historically, and even presently in certain traditional medicine systems , these calculi dust have been ascribed to hold unique therapeutic qualities , possibly assisting in the care of hepatic conditions and functioning as an bile mover . Further investigation is necessary to definitively validate these statements.
